Summary
"The flow of information through our modern digital world has led to many new issues and controversies. Net Neutralityexamines the question of whether Internet service providers should be able to charge content providers for faster connections, introducing readers to the history behind the issue and the modern arguments surrounding it." --, Provided by publisher
